Voice Notes Reintroduced on X Chat: Enhancing User Experience




Voice Notes have been reintroduced to X Chat, the social media platform owned by Elon Musk, allowing users to send audio messages once more. This feature had been removed previously but is now available for both individual and group conversations, though it will not be available for public posts.

In a recent announcement, the company shared that Voice Notes on X Chat is now available to improve the chat experience as competitors like WhatsApp continue to lead the instant messaging sector.

Voice Notes Returns: Key Features

According to the company’s announcement, Voice Notes is being rolled out within X Chat, the direct messaging system of the X app. To initiate an audio message, users should click on the voice input icon located near the text box. Recording requires users to press and hold a button while speaking.

Additionally, there is an alternative recording method where users can press the button and then swipe up to capture audio hands-free.

Voice messaging is a standard feature across many messaging platforms. By reintroducing it, X appears to be positioning itself to compete more effectively with other applications, making X Chat more appealing for users who prefer audio communication over typing.

X Chat offers a variety of additional features, including message editing and deletion, user blocking, screenshot notifications, file sharing, video calling, and more. This enhancement aligns with Elon Musk’s ambition to evolve X into an “everything app.”

Moreover, the company is also experimenting with financial features such as X Money, which is expected to provide payment services within the X application and is reportedly being trialed as a standalone app.
